So so gorgeous! Do you know what months you actually retwistes, or you never retwisted from starter locs? Just wondering how your parts stayed in place!
@aleshakate2 жыл бұрын
Thank you so much! I retwisted up until month 7! When I would wash I would still try to separate gently at the roots to maintain my parting as best as I could. As my locs matured I didn’t have much separating to do ☺️
